# SQL Linting: Environments

All SQL files in the Bramblegate repos pass through the Quillcheck linter before merge. Staging and production share one ruleset; the sandbox environment relaxes naming checks only. New team members should not override rules locally — exceptions go through the platform channel. The active ruleset settings for production are listed below.

config for kagup-hahig:
druwyn:
  pin: 2801
  metrics_host: metrics.druwyn.zemvarlabs.internal
  tenant: sorius
  seal: seal_798a43d7

## Welcome to DocSmith Duty

If you're on call for the Pinwick docs linter, most pages self-heal on the next CI run — don't panic at red badges. The linter only blocks merges on broken cross-references and stale snippets. If the lint job itself won't start, it's usually the runner's deploy credentials expiring. Re-provision the runner and re-register it, then paste in the current deploy key, which is.

deploy key for kajof-fajop: bky6_gDHw9Q

Following the Orchardline stale-cache incident, we are documenting the limits and quotas that caused reminder data to persist past invalidation. The root cause was a TTL longer than the upstream refresh window, combined with an unbounded entry count. Please review these values carefully against the invalidation flow. The corrected limits now in production are as follows.

constants for fajop-tahaf:
RATE_LIMITS = {
    "holael": 2,
    "oliael": 10,
    "druael": 10,
    "wenwyn": 10,
}

09:41 — Incremental rebuilds on the Larkspur publishing pipeline began skipping pages whose only change was a shared layout partial. New folks should know: our dependency graph treats partials as second-class nodes, so the invalidation pass missed them entirely. Roughly 400 stale pages served for two hours before Priya Onsdale noticed mismatched footers. A full rebuild cleared it, and the graph walker was patched the same afternoon. The fixed build is referenced below.

build token for kagaf-hahof: htk14_9d3d4d26d7d8de